Khōst, Afghanistan

Region: Khōst province


Geographic Coordinates: 33.333100, 69.916900
Temperature Range: -10.0°C to 35.0°C (14°F to 95°F)
Population: 160214
Language: Pashto

Khost is the capital of Khost Province in southeastern Afghanistan, Situated on the banks of the Khost River. The city’s location makes it a crucial transportation hub for goods and people traveling between Afghanistan and Pakistan. The area has a long history dating back to ancient times when it was part of the Gandhara civilization. Over time, Various ethnic groups have inhabited Khost, Including Pashtuns, Tajiks, And Hazaras. Despite its strategic location for trade and commerce, Khost has faced significant challenges due to conflict with Taliban forces since 1996.

However, Locals still rely heavily on agriculture with wheat being one of its main crops alongside fruits such as apples and pomegranates. Livestock farming is also common in Khost. Residents can enjoy Tani District Park for recreational activities such as playgrounds or tennis courts after long work hours or during weekends. Education facilities available within Khōst include schools like Zarghona High School that provides education up until twelfth grade level, A polytechnic institute that offers vocational training in fields such as construction and mechanics along with Khost University which was established in 2006.

despite ongoing conflicts over the years; Khost remains an important cultural hub for southeastern Afghanistan due to its rich history dating back to ancient times along with being an important center for trade and commerce.
